Java基础:第10章 JDBC数据库编程详解及驱动选择
版权申诉
5星 · 超过95%的资源 35 浏览量
更新于2024-07-08
收藏 331KB PPT 举报
本篇内容主要讲解的是Java基础入门教程中的第10章——JDBC数据库编程。JDBC (Java Database Connectivity) 是Java提供的一种用于与关系数据库进行交互的API,使得Java程序员能够通过标准的Java代码操作各种类型的数据库。以下是章节要点的详细说明:
1. **JDBC的作用**:
- JDBC的核心作用是为Java应用程序提供了一种通用的接口,以便在Java中执行SQL语句,实现对数据库的访问。
- 它使得开发人员能够独立于底层数据库技术,以统一的方式编写数据库操作代码。
2. **JDBC驱动类型**:
- **JDBC-ODBC桥加ODBC驱动**:这是一种早期的连接方式,利用ODBC作为中间层,虽然易于学习但效率较低,且需要额外配置ODBC环境。
- **本地协议纯Java驱动**:更为高效,但需要特定的JDBC驱动程序,并且针对不同数据库可能需要不同的驱动,对开发者的要求较高。
3. **JDBC编程步骤**:
- 下载并安装对应数据库的JDBC驱动程序,如Oracle、SQL Server、MySQL等官方提供的JAR文件。
- 在代码中加载驱动,通常通过`Class.forName()`方法动态注册。
4. **创建ODBC数据源**:
- 用户需要通过操作系统界面(如Windows的控制面板)创建ODBC数据源,以便Java程序能够识别和连接到数据库。
5. **加载驱动**:
- 使用`try-catch`块来加载JDBC驱动,确保在运行时正确注册,例如`sun.jdbc.odbc.JdbcOdbcDriver`和`com.microsoft.sqlserver.jdbc.SQLServerDriver`。
6. **数据库操作流程**:
- 包括建立数据库连接、创建执行SQL语句的对象、执行查询、处理结果集以及最后关闭连接,这些都是JDBC编程的基本步骤。
通过学习这一章,Java开发者将掌握如何在Java程序中有效地与数据库交互,无论是通过JDBC-ODBC桥还是直接使用纯Java驱动,都是企业级应用开发中不可或缺的基础技能。此外,了解和熟练运用这些步骤对于编写健壮、可扩展的数据库操作代码至关重要。
2021-12-04 上传
2021-12-25 上传
2021-12-04 上传
2021-12-04 上传
2021-12-04 上传
2021-12-06 上传
2021-12-18 上传
2023-07-30 上传
passionSnail
- 粉丝: 448
- 资源: 6875
最新资源
- JDK 17 Linux版本压缩包解压与安装指南
- C++/Qt飞行模拟器教员控制台系统源码发布
- TensorFlow深度学习实践:CNN在MNIST数据集上的应用
- 鸿蒙驱动HCIA资料整理-培训教材与开发者指南
- 凯撒Java版SaaS OA协同办公软件v2.0特性解析
- AutoCAD二次开发中文指南下载 - C#编程深入解析
- C语言冒泡排序算法实现详解
- Pointofix截屏:轻松实现高效截图体验
- Matlab实现SVM数据分类与预测教程
- 基于JSP+SQL的网站流量统计管理系统设计与实现
- C语言实现删除字符中重复项的方法与技巧
- e-sqlcipher.dll动态链接库的作用与应用
- 浙江工业大学自考网站开发与继续教育官网模板设计
- STM32 103C8T6 OLED 显示程序实现指南
- 高效压缩技术:删除重复字符压缩包
- JSP+SQL智能交通管理系统:违章处理与交通效率提升